- Unsaved workspace corruption – Switching languages while a drawing is open can reset custom workspaces.
- Command alias conflicts – For example, the
COPY command in English might be COPIER in French. Hot switching can cause macro failures.
- Font and SHX file mismatches – Non-Unicode drawings may display gibberish after switching to a double-byte language (e.g., Japanese).
- LISP and ARX compatibility – Custom applications referencing hardcoded English command names will break if switched to German.
- Autodesk updates – An official update (hotfix or security patch) might overwrite hot-patched files, reverting to default language.
- Support void – Autodesk Support will not troubleshoot issues arising from unofficial hot-patched language packs.
